David Raya has been selected to start for Arsenal in their Premier League match against Leicester City today. The Spanish goalkeeper was initially a doubt for the game after suffering what manager Mikel Arteta described as a “muscle injury” during Arsenal’s 2-2 draw with Manchester City last Sunday. However, Raya has been deemed fit to reclaim his position in goal as Arsenal take on Leicester at the Emirates Stadium.

During Arsenal’s midweek League Cup match against Bolton Wanderers, 16-year-old Jack Porter was called up to replace Raya in goal, and the young goalkeeper performed well in the team’s 5-1 victory. Despite this, Raya returns to the starting lineup for the Premier League fixture, which is crucial as Arsenal look to continue their strong start to the season.

Arsenal’s starting lineup remains unchanged from their last Premier League encounter against Manchester City. The defensive line will feature Jurrien Timber, Gabriel Magalhães, William Saliba, and Riccardo Calafiori, providing protection for Raya between the posts.

In midfield, Declan Rice will be partnered with Thomas Partey, while Kai Havertz is expected to drop deeper during the game to assist in both attack and defense. The attacking trio will consist of Bukayo Saka, Leandro Trossard, and Gabriel Martinelli, with their pace and creativity key to breaking down Leicester’s defense.

One notable absence from the matchday squad is Ben White, who missed the League Cup tie against Bolton due to an undisclosed injury. His absence raises concerns, but Arsenal still have a strong bench to call upon if needed, including the likes of Neto, Jorginho, and Gabriel Jesus.

Arsenal’s starting XI is set up in a 4-3-3 formation, with David Raya in goal, a backline of Timber, Gabriel, Saliba, and Calafiori, a midfield trio of Rice, Partey, and Havertz, and an attacking trio of Saka, Trossard, and Martinelli.
